From May to July, I was looking to switch my career path from a Graphic Designer to a UX Designer. I heard in order to do this, a UX certificate program would be a great starting point to learn the necessary skills to become a UX Designer. I stumbled upon American Graphics Institute while doing my research for UX boot camps in my area and decided to take the UX Design Certificate program. My experience at AGI was a very positive one. I wanted to complete the program as soon as possible and the staff was very accommodating creating a class schedule for me in order to complete the program in a timely manner. When taking the classes, the teachers and staff were very informative on their subject matter and prepared me for a real world UX Design position. They were helpful with any questions I had inside and outside of the classroom. For example, they would provide me with their email at the end of class in case I needed help with something we learned in class. Not only were the classes informative, best of all, the certificate program also provides a personal career counselor that helps prepare you for a UX position. This was the selling point for me because not many other schools provide a career counselor. Bruce, the career counselor, helped improve my Resume and would consistently check in on me with regards to my job search. It was very refreshing to have some guidance while searching for a position. After completing the program, three months later I was offered a position as a Junior UX Design specialist. Although I did not get this UX position through AGI, I would not have been offered this UX Design position without this certificate program. I am forever grateful for this school and the opportunities it has given me.
